#76826F Hex color

#76826F

The hexadecimal color code #76826F corresponds to the code RGB( 118, 130, 111 ). It's a shade of Gray. This color is a combination of red (at 0,46 level), green (at 0,51 level) and blue (at 0,44 level). Its brightness is 47% and its saturation is 7%. It is composed of red at 32%, green at 36% and blue at 30%.
